Y = 2 - 2

y = 3x +4
Is (4, 2) a solution of the system?
Choose 1 answer:
А)
Yes
B
No

Answer:

B. No

Explanation:

In order to see if (4, 2) is a solution, we have to plug 4 in for x and 2 in for y in the equations. If it's a true statement, then we know that the point is a solution.

One of the equations is y = 3x + 4. Plug in 4 for x and 2 for y:

y =? 3x + 4

2 =? 3 * 4 + 4

2 =? 12 + 4

2 ≠ 16

Thus, we know that (4, 2) is not a solution and the answer is B.
